Introduction: IPod Stylus
This is dirt cheap to make a stylus and works great. The reason this works is iPod screens detect the electrons coming off your fingers so the tinfoil part of this project acts as a conductor for the electrons so the screen can detect the stylus touching the screen.
Step 1: What You Need
- Tinfoil
- Scissors
- Tape
- a Pen
- Cloth or an ear plug (optional)
Step 2: Step 1
cut out about a 2 inch square of tinfoil
Step 3: Step 2
Cover the end of the pen with tinfoil and tape it on but leave a tab of tinfoil UN-taped to act as the conductor
(optional)- You can put thin cloth over the tip to make it slide easier
Step 4: How to Use
The way to use it is to put your finger on the tab of untapped tinfoil and touch the screen with the tinfoil tip
Tip: if you put cloth over it and its not working it is probably because the cloth is too thick so the electrons cant get to the screen so either take it off and use a thinner cloth or just take it off and use it plain.
